
Gold Rush
A downloadable game for Windows

Explore the procedurally generated mine, collect gold and use it to build fast movement contraptions that allow you to push deeper and deeper into the mine before your oxygen runs out. Hopefully, you will eventually find the legendary heart of Koh Gamui, rumored to grant unimaginable power.

Gold Rush is a 3D sidescroller using voxel graphics. It is a singleplayer game that can be played with keyboard and mouse. The goal of the game is to find the Heart of Koh Gamui.
In a team of 6 students, we developed Gold Rush as part of the Game Programming Laboratory at ETH Zurich. We hope you have as much fun playing it as we had creating it!
